For residents facing mental health challenges or substance use disorders,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P) offer a vital lifeline. These programs provide flexible treatment options designed to fit the busy lives of Philmont residents while maintaining their commitments to work and family.
With an emphasis on personalized care, Virtual IOPs enable local residents to engage in structured therapy from the comfort of their homes. These programs are designed to cater to a variety of mental health issues, including anxiety, depression, PTSD, and bipolar disorder. Residents can benefit from a range of therapies, including group sessions, individual therapy, and even family counseling, all facilitated by licensed professionals who understand the unique context of the Philmont community.
